Visitors to the gallery can meet Rachael on Saturday, October 12 from 11am to 2pm.

Her work will then be on display each Saturday for four weeks.

Rachael said: “As an artist and nurse deeply inspired by the interplay of colour and emotion, my work reflects a journey of self-discovery and expression.
